Materials And Roofing Systems

Choosing the right materials is central to performance and value. Common residential options include asphalt shingles for cost efficiency and wide availability, architectural shingles for enhanced curb appeal, and premium options such as metal, clay, and concrete for longer lifespans and durability. For commercial properties, TPO, EPDM, and built-up roofing (BUR) systems are widely used. A reputable contractor will assess climate, roof pitch, ventilation, insulation, and structural support to determine the best material and system for durability, energy efficiency, and maintenance needs.

Licensing, Insurance, And Safety

U.S. roofing projects require proper licensing and adequate insurance. Responsible contractors carry general liability insurance, workers’ compensation, and proof of licensing in the jurisdictions where they operate. Safety programs, including fall protection, harnessing, and PPE, are essential due to the inherently hazardous nature of roofing work. Homeowners should request credentials, verify coverage limits, and review safety records before contracting. Transparent documentation reduces risk for both parties and ensures compliance with local building codes and industry standards.

Maintenance And Preventive Care

Preventive maintenance helps detect issues before they become costly repairs. Routine tasks include clearing debris, inspecting for loose or damaged shingles, checking flashing around chimneys and vents, and ensuring proper attic ventilation. Many contractors offer maintenance plans with periodic inspections and discounted repair rates. Proactive care reduces the likelihood of leaks during severe weather and supports energy efficiency by maintaining consistent insulation performance.

Energy Efficiency And Sustainability

Roofing choices influence home energy use. Reflective or cool roofing materials, proper insulation, and effective ventilation can reduce cooling loads in hot climates. For commercial buildings, energy-efficient roofing systems may contribute to LEED or other green certifications. Contractors can advise on radiant barriers, venting improvements, and solar-ready configurations. Emphasizing sustainability helps homeowners save on energy bills while lowering environmental impact.

Local Market Considerations

U.S. roofing needs are shaped by climate, weather events, and regional building codes. Areas prone to hurricanes, heavy snowfall, or hail require systems designed for impact resistance and rapid drainage. Local codes affect permit processes and inspection requirements. A capable contractor stays informed about regional specifications and obtains necessary credentials to ensure compliance and timely project completion.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What should I look for in a roofing estimate? A detailed scope of work, materials, labor, removal, disposal, permits, timelines, and warranty terms.
  • How often should a roof be inspected? A professional inspection twice a year, plus after major storms, is a common best practice.
  • Are metal roofs worth the extra cost? Metal roofs offer durability, energy efficiency, and longer lifespans, but upfront costs are higher. Consider climate and building design.
  • How long does a typical roof replacement take? Most residential roofs take 1–3 days depending on size, weather, and complexity.
